Expert Guide: How an AM PM Calculator Works and Why It Matters

An AM PM calculator is a practical tool used to solve one of the most common everyday problems: figuring out what time comes after adding or subtracting a certain number of hours and minutes from a 12-hour clock value. While the math sounds simple, real-world time calculations often become confusing when a schedule crosses noon, midnight, or multiple calendar boundaries. A reliable AM PM calculator removes that friction by handling the conversions accurately and presenting the answer in a clear format.

The 12-hour clock separates the day into two periods. AM refers to the hours after midnight and before noon, while PM refers to the hours after noon and before midnight. The challenge is that 12:00 AM and 12:00 PM are easy to misread, and time arithmetic can become error-prone when you mentally switch between morning and afternoon. That is why this type of calculator is useful for students, nurses, shift workers, travelers, dispatchers, appointment coordinators, and anyone planning a schedule across multiple blocks of time.

In practical terms, an AM PM calculator takes a starting hour, a minute value, and an AM or PM designation, then applies a duration by adding or subtracting it. The tool can then express the result both as a familiar 12-hour clock time and as a 24-hour value, which is especially useful in transportation, healthcare, military contexts, software systems, and international communication.

Why Time Calculation Errors Happen So Often

Time calculation mistakes usually occur for three reasons. First, people often mix up noon and midnight. Second, adding minutes can push the total across an hour or period boundary without the user noticing. Third, converting between 12-hour and 24-hour time introduces another layer of mental work. A strong calculator automates all three steps.

The two most misunderstood labels are 12:00 AM and 12:00 PM. In standard 12-hour notation, 12:00 AM is midnight and 12:00 PM is noon.

For example, if you start at 11:40 PM and add 1 hour 35 minutes, the result is not simply 12:75 PM or another informal shortcut. The correct answer is 1:15 AM on the next day. The calculator handles the minute rollover, the hour rollover, and the AM/PM transition automatically.

How the Calculator Converts AM and PM

Behind the scenes, most AM PM calculators convert the starting time into total minutes after midnight. That approach is clean and accurate because all time arithmetic can be performed using a single numeric scale. Once the math is done, the final total is converted back into a human-readable 12-hour result and, if needed, a 24-hour clock value.

Basic Conversion Rules

  1. If the time is AM and the hour is 12, convert the hour to 0 for 24-hour calculation.
  2. If the time is AM and the hour is 1 through 11, keep the same hour.
  3. If the time is PM and the hour is 12, keep the hour as 12.
  4. If the time is PM and the hour is 1 through 11, add 12 to get the 24-hour hour value.
  5. Convert the hour to minutes and add the minute field.
  6. Add or subtract the duration in minutes.
  7. Normalize the total so it stays within a 24-hour cycle.
  8. Convert the result back into 12-hour and 24-hour formats.
12-Hour Time 24-Hour Time Total Minutes After Midnight Meaning
12:00 AM 00:00 0 Midnight, the start of the day
1:00 AM 01:00 60 One hour after midnight
11:59 AM 11:59 719 One minute before noon
12:00 PM 12:00 720 Noon, halfway through a 24-hour day
1:00 PM 13:00 780 One hour after noon
11:59 PM 23:59 1439 One minute before midnight

Examples of Accurate Time Math

Consider a few examples that show why a calculator is safer than mental arithmetic. If you begin at 8:15 AM and add 2 hours 50 minutes, the result is 11:05 AM. If you start at 10:45 AM and add 2 hours 30 minutes, the result is 1:15 PM. Notice that the calculation crosses noon, so the period changes from AM to PM. If you start at 1:10 AM and subtract 2 hours 25 minutes, the result is 10:45 PM on the previous day. This kind of backward calculation is where many users benefit most from an automated tool.

Another advantage is consistency. In healthcare, manufacturing, logistics, and remote operations, even a small timing error can disrupt workflows. A calculator provides an exact answer every time and can also show the result in both clock systems for easier communication.

Sample Scenarios

  • Start 9:30 PM, add 2 hours 45 minutes = 12:15 AM
  • Start 11:20 AM, add 55 minutes = 12:15 PM
  • Start 12:10 AM, add 30 minutes = 12:40 AM
  • Start 12:10 PM, add 30 minutes = 12:40 PM
  • Start 6:00 PM, subtract 8 hours = 10:00 AM

12-Hour Clock vs 24-Hour Clock

The 12-hour clock is the most familiar format in the United States and several other countries, especially in daily conversation. The 24-hour clock is common in transportation, military systems, international timetables, computing, scientific logging, and many global regions. An AM PM calculator serves as a bridge between these systems. It lets users work naturally in AM and PM while still generating a precise 24-hour result.

According to the National Institute of Standards and Technology, precise timekeeping is foundational for communications, navigation, finance, and data systems. While a personal scheduling calculation may seem small compared with national time standards, the same principle applies: accurate and standardized time interpretation prevents mistakes. Context Typical Time Format Why It Is Used Example
Casual daily conversation 12-hour More intuitive for many people 7:30 PM dinner
Airlines and rail systems 24-hour Reduces ambiguity 19:30 departure
Hospitals and medication logs 24-hour Prevents AM/PM confusion 07:00 dose, 19:00 dose
Schools and offices Mostly 12-hour Fits everyday local convention 8:00 AM start
Software timestamps 24-hour Machine-friendly standardization 2025-08-20 21:14

Important Facts About Time Measurement

To understand any AM PM calculator, it helps to remember a few fixed facts: a day contains 24 hours, each hour contains 60 minutes, and each full day contains 1,440 minutes. Those are not arbitrary assumptions made by a calculator. They are the standard building blocks of civil time. When you use a calculator to add or subtract time, the software is ultimately moving along a 1,440-minute cycle and then translating the result back into readable notation.

If your calculation goes beyond one day, a high-quality tool should either wrap around within the 24-hour cycle or indicate that the result lands on the next or previous day. This page does both conceptually by normalizing the clock result and showing how many minutes were applied.

Best Practices When Using an AM PM Calculator

  1. Double-check whether your starting time is AM or PM before calculating.
  2. Use exact minutes instead of rounded estimates when scheduling tightly timed activities.
  3. Be especially careful with 12:00 AM and 12:00 PM.
  4. For travel, healthcare, or technical use, also review the 24-hour output.
  5. If your schedule spans midnight, confirm whether the result is on the next day.
  6. Keep a timezone note when relevant, especially for remote meetings and flights.

Common Formatting Questions

Is 12:00 AM noon?

No. 12:00 AM is midnight. Noon is 12:00 PM.

Why does 12 PM not become 24:00?

Because 12:00 PM is noon, which is represented as 12:00 in 24-hour time. Midnight at the start of the day is 00:00.
